#1c0564 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1c0564 is composed of 11% red, 2%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72% cyan, 95%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 254.5 degrees, a saturation of 90.5% and a lightness of 20.6%. #1c0564 color hex could be obtained by blending #380ac8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#1c0564
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020007 is the darkest color, while #f6f3f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1c0564
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#333138 is the less saturated color, while #1a0168 is the most saturated one.
